Kibaran (ASX:KNL) is developing its Epanko natural graphite deposit in Tanzania and battery (spherical) graphite development programme with the aim to be major producer of premium, large flake for the traditional and battery graphite for the Lithium-ion battery market. The Epanko graphite project and downstream manufacturing of battery graphite are long-life, highly profitable, scalable businesses. Graphite is a major component of the Lithium-ion battery and the company has recently developed a proprietary eco-friendly purification process (EcoGraf) for the production of its battery (Spherical) graphite. EcoGraf is a green environmentally friendly process and is commercially viable alternative to the existing Chinese supply. The demand for battery graphite is increasing rapidly and the company expects both the Electric Vehicle and Energy Storage markets will demand a socially and environmentally friendly source of key raw materials.
